2017-05-11 2 views
1

Ich benutze ionc3 mit 'tabs layout', 'ionic serve', 'IonPageModule' für die entwicklung, in chrom.ionic3 tabs layout, wie man den zustand bei ionischem aufladen in chrom beibehalten

  1. , wenn ich die andere Komponente bearbeiten (nicht der Root-Seite der ersten Registerkarte) und sie gespeichert haben. Der Browser wird neu geladen und navigiert immer zur ersten Registerkarte der Registerkarte .
  2. Obwohl für jede Seite eine URL vorhanden ist, laden Sie den Browser neu, der Status kann nicht gespeichert werden, die Stammseite der ersten Registerkarte wurde aktiviert.

    Wenn meine App viele Seiten hat, ist dies ein wirklich ernstes Problem.

    reference

Antwort

1

, die eigentlich nicht möglich ist. Nachdem Sie Ihren Code geändert und gespeichert haben, verhält sich das Live-Neuladen von Ionic so, als ob Sie die Anwendung neu gestartet hätten, um die neuen logischen Änderungen zu berücksichtigen (beachten Sie, dass .scss-Änderungen direkt angewendet werden können).

Wenn Sie den Status speichern müssen, benötigen Sie eine Datenbank oder verwenden Sie den Speicher.

+0

Vielen Dank für Ihre Antwort aber wenn die App viele Seiten hat, ist dies ein wirklich ernstes Problem, da Ionische Winkelrouter aufgeben ,. – viola

+0

Vielleicht vermisse ich einen Punkt, aber wie ist es ein ernstes Problem? Wenn Sie eine App auf Ihrem Telefon öffnen, landen Sie normalerweise auf einer Art "Startseite". Das ist eigentlich ein ziemlich normales Verhalten. – Kaixin

+0

Ich öffne nur die App im Browser, ich einfach nur Webapp ohne Cordova. Ich entwickle die App und Vorschau in Chrom. Das ist also ein großes Problem für die Entwicklung und Debugging im Browser. Mybe das ist ein nicht richtiger Weg ... – viola

Verwandte Themen